#303b03 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#303b03 is composed of 18.8% red, 23.1%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.9% yellow and 76.9% black. It has a hue angle of 71.8 degrees, a saturation of 90.3% and a lightness of 12.2%. #303b03 color hex could be obtained by blending #607606 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#303b03 color description : Very dark yellow [Olive tone].
#303b03 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#303b03 has RGB values of R:48, G:59,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0, Y:0.95, K:0.77. Its decimal value is 3160835.

Shades and Tints of #303b03
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020300 is the darkest color, while #fbfeef is the lightest one.

Tones of #303b03
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#20211d is the less saturated color, while #313d01 is the most saturated one.
